If Tyrell Williams is going to succeed in 2018 it is likely like Adam Thielan did - a combination of opportunity, continued struggles/injuries from other WRs and himself taking another step forward.

So basically he'll need at least 2 of Allen, Benjamim & Williams to struggle (or be injured) as well as show he is ready for an increased role (vs being force fed due to last man standing).

It is certainy possible - but like others have alluded to - UDFAs have extra obstacles in their path to succeed, their time in the sun is usually shorter (because they have to keep proving it over & over) and there is usually a pedigreed player coming soon to replace them if they falter / injury.

If he is lucky though, he'll get a nice 2nd landing spot like Hurns or Hogan did.

I think so long as Keenan Allen remains healthy, no other WR in SD's offense can reach better than fantasy WR3/4 value. Tyrell or Mike, doesn't matter. I don't think Henry's injury makes much of a difference, either. Except to Allen, that is, who presumably will now soak up even more targets between the hashmarks.

Tyrell is a boundary vertical weapon, and that has little overlap with Henry's usage. If trends since Whisenhunt took over as OC in '16 hold steady, Henry's injury should primarily benefit Allen and the running-backs' involvement as pass-catchers in the middle of the field.

Playing all 3 positions in LAC is important .. all 3 WR's last year were split evenly whether it was the left, right or slot .. Until Mike Williams can play all 3 positions he won't take over the 3 WR, only other option I could see is they jam in the X, and let Keenan, with either Gazelle or Benjamin move around much like Diggs and Thielen ..

I also could see M Williams only being used in the red zone, like Gazelle, Keenan, and Benjamin between the 20s and then M Williams, Gazelle and Keenan in the red zone ..
